02 Oct 2016

Young, innocent Lahula's mother Mathru and elder sister Rajjo have multiple husbands at the same time. Illegal but socially accepted polyandry is practiced in their community for various socio-economic reasons. Multiple brothers share one woman as their wife and she is supposed to sexually oblige all of them in equal manner. Lahula loves Shiv and wants to marry him. Shiv has been disowned by his family because he refused to share his elder brother's wife. Lahula doesn't succumb to this unethical, emotionally not acceptable, illegal custom and rebels when she is forced by her parents to marry Daulatram along with his three brothers. She compels the society to rethink the way they treat women -the society, which is obsessed with having only male child.

14 Apr 2017

Saanjh marks the debut of Producer and Director, Ajay K Saklani, who, through this movie attempts to bring to the fore the lesser known Himachali language and tries to revive the almost forgotten Tankri Script. Saanjh is the first feature film to have been made and released in the Western Himalayan/ Pahari language. The serenity of village life amidst the Himalayas reaches the peak of sublimity as the visual tour is accompanied by some of the most melodious songs rendered by Mohit Chauhan and Pavithra Chari which strike the heart strings of even those who are unfamiliar with the Pahari dialect. The movie provides a perfect audio-visual setting for a beautiful confluence of the emotional journeys of a daughter, a mother and an orphaned boy as the sun sets on their lives and dusk sets in. Saanjh was the first film in Himachali dialect to be released in cinema halls across India.

05 Mar 1999

Lal Baadshah is a 1999 Bollywood film directed by K.C. Bokadia and starring Amitabh Bachchan in a dual role, Raghuvaran, Manisha Koirala, Shilpa Shetty and Amrish Puri. Nirupa Roy also appears in her last film playing Bachchan's foster mother. This was Bachchan's third film since his comeback after a five-year hiatus; it failed at the box office but hit in Uttar Pradesh and Bihar.
